The Bhagavad Gita, often referred to GITA, is a 700 verse Hindu scripture in Sanskrit that is a part of Hindu epic MAHABHARATA. The Bhagavad Gita presents a SYNTHESIS of the concept of Dharma,Bhakti,the Yogic ideals of moksha through jnana, bhakti.,karma and Raja Yoga. The word "bhagavadgīta" is popularly translated as the song of God, or the celestial song. Gītam means both a song and an act of singing or chanting. It also means what is told, declared or chanted, which is usually a reference to a sacred writing, transmitted knowledge, a religious conversation or a spiritual dialogue. In Hinduism, there are many Gītas, such as Shivagīta, Ramagīta, Astavakragīta, Avadhutagīta, Devigīta etc. They are named after the names of the deities or the teachers who are their source.
